AS!N ASPIRATION EXHIBITION 3 AUG ’23 – 3 SEP ’23 AT CENTRAL: THE ORIGINAL STORE
Ong-Ekarat Nakanukroh, also known as AS!N, began communicating with people through his mural paintings about ten years ago. When his journey to becoming a graphic designer came to an end, he reflected on his childhood, when all he wanted to do was to draw and to share his thoughts with the society and people around him. He decided to create mural art and started to produce a number of art pieces, participate in street art, and organize group exhibitions with Thai and international artists before mounting his first solo show at the Midnight Gallery. He held another solo exhibition in 2017 after accepting an invitation from a German spectator to participate in the 48th Stunden Art 2018 Festival in Berlin. His solo exhibition took place in a gallery in Nagoya, Japan in 2019 and he has continued to develop and display his works to the public.
AS!N’s latest solo exhibition, ASPIRATION, aims to inspire optimism and positive thinking by giving his viewers the ability to imagine their futures being filled with happiness. Through his expertise, he displays 17 brightly colored and unique graffiti works featuring his signature ‘chicken’ character.
AS!N has been exhibiting works that reflect the stories of society for a long time highlighting contemporary issues that he feels need to be resolved, including environmental problems and social issues such as inequity. For this exhibition, AS!N has changed his perspective from originally wanting to call for change to instead creating what we want to happen by making the change ourselves.
